   I had the day off today and decided to take my wife's Durango in for an   
   alignment.  She had hit a curb about 2 years ago and the right front tire was   
   wearing bad on the outside of the tire.   
      
   First mistake was going to Midas - who had the lowest price on the alignment.   
   I got there at 11:30am and they were not finished until 3:00pm.  A 3 1/2 hour   
   alignment.   
      
   Note:  No one else was in the place but me.  One customer!     
      
   They kept telling me they were having problems getting it aligned.  Then after   
   3 1/2 hrs, they tell me it is done, but not 100% because the control arm is   
   bent.  Why they did this and waited 3 1/2 hours to tell me this is beyond me.   
   They said it is "safe" and that they did the best they could.   
      
   I drove it down the road and the stearing wheel was almost 90 degrees of (to   
   the right).  I turned around, dropped it back off and told them to straighten   
   the wheel.  They first said that is how I must drive it until I get a new   
   control arm and I told them the car was in better shape before I took it there.   
      
   I told them if they don't fix the wheel, I will void the charge and take it   
   somewhere else.  They then said they could fix the stearing wheel and 45   
   minutes later, it was straight again. Seems to be ok. 4 1/2 hours of pure hell.   
      
   What a fun day off work.. :(
